# illiberal

> English word · Adjective · frequency rank #56,194

## Definitions
1. Restricting or failing to sufficiently promote individual choice and freedom.
2. Narrow-minded; bigoted.
3. Ungenerous, stingy.
4. Not adhering to either liberalism or neoliberalism.

## Etymology
From Middle French illibéral, from Latin illiberalis, equivalent to il- + liberal.
